Plate Number 25. Walking with shoes on

1887

Eadweard Muybridge

Associated Names
Eadweard Muybridge

Artist, American, born England, 1830 - 1904

This is a photograph of a sequence capturing a form in motion. The image is a series of frames arranged in two rows, depicting a nude figure walking. Each frame shows a progression of movement, allowing the viewer to observe the subtle changes in posture and limb positioning as the figure moves forward. The top row shows a side view, while the bottom row captures the figure from the rear. The background consists of a grid pattern, likely used as a reference for studying movement, emphasizing both the scientific and aesthetic aspects of the composition.

Provenance

Eadweard Muybridge, Philadelphia, PA; purchased by the Corcoran Gallery of Art, Washington, DC, 1887; acquired by NGA, 2014.

Inscriptions

printed, lower center underneath image in black ink: ANIMAL LOCOMOTION. PLATE. 25 / Copyright, 1887, by EADWEARD MUYBRIDGE. All rights reserved.; on verso, by Corcoran Gallery of Art, lower left in red pencil: 87.7.25
